The GridShare solution: a smart grid approach to improve
Bhutan Department of Energy (DoE), this system was piloted in Rukubji, Bhutan, a village of approximately 90 households connected to a micro-hydroelectric system rated at 40 kW. In Rukubji, like many other mini-grids, the power supply is sufficient during off-peak times. However, during preparation of morning and evening meals, the use of

Tata Power and Bhutan''s Druk Green Power
Tata Power has been a key player in Bhutan''s energy sector since 2008 when it helped develop the 126 MW Dagachhu Hydropower Plant—the first public-private partnership in Bhutan''s hydropower sector. 2,500 MW of pumped storage, and 500 MW of solar energy. The projects will ensure a round-the-clock energy supply to both Bhutan and India.
Feasibility of renewable energy storage using hydrogen in
This paper considers the technical and economic feasibility of using renewable energy with hydrogen as the energy storage medium for two remote communities in Bhutan, selected to illustrate two common scenarios presenting different challenges. In India''s Three-Way Energy Storage Race, Hydel''s
It''s also readying a large push on pumped storage. As energy minister R.K. Singh told Economic Times, the NDA has identified 63 projects adding up to a generating capacity of 96,000 MW. The catch: India is pushing hydel storage at a time when rival storage technologies like batteries and electrolysers are evolving rapidly.
